What people ask before they enrol
How long is the course?
The course is 18 training hours, delivered over 3 weeks.
Can I attend online?
Yes. You can attend in person in the computer lab at Sarh’s premises in Amman, or join live online from home.
What language is the course taught in?
Instruction and course material are in Arabic.
Is the course theoretical or hands-on?
It is fully practical: short explanations followed by direct work on files and exercises, built on practical application, simulation, and hands-on drills.
Do I need my own laptop or a specific Excel version?
Trainees work on their own device during the sessions, and the required Excel version is confirmed before the course starts.
Can I pay in instalments?
Yes. The price shown on the page is the full-payment price, and a monthly-instalment option is available at the crossed-out figure shown beside it.
When does the next cohort start?
Cohorts run throughout the year. Get in touch to confirm the next start date and reserve a place.
Who is this course for?
Accountants and finance professionals — fresh graduates, financial accountants, financial managers and controllers, auditors, and data and budget analysts who use Excel for reporting, reconciliations, and analysis.
